Back Midas Rome Roody Rootana
  Midas DAQ System  Not logged in ELOG logo
Entry  14 Oct 2016, Konstantin Olchanski, Info, Javascript based run start and stop pages. 
    Reply  05 Dec 2016, Thomas Lindner, Info, Javascript based run start and stop pages. 
       Reply  01 Feb 2017, Konstantin Olchanski, Info, Javascript based run start and stop pages. 
          Reply  01 Feb 2017, Stefan Ritt, Info, Javascript based run start and stop pages. 
Message ID: 1224     Entry time: 05 Dec 2016     In reply to: 1213     Reply to this: 1232
Author: Thomas Lindner 
Topic: Info 
Subject: Javascript based run start and stop pages. 
> I switched mhttpd to use the new javascript based run start and stop pages.

One initial complaint: the transition.html page doesn't seem to deal well with a frontend program using
a deferred transition.  Specifically, I find with my simulated frontend ([1]), which has a deferred
end-of-run transition, that two problems happen:

i) the page doesn't give any indication that a frontend has a deferred transition; in fact it says that
the frontend immediately has finished the transition.
ii) once the deferred transition has finished, the page doesn't switch to saying that the run has
stopped.  In fact, even if I reload the transition page it still continues to show that the run is
ongoing; the status page, by contrast, shows that the run has stopped.

I separately still think that the transition page should automatically go away after 5 seconds
(assuming that all the transitions were successful).  I think it is annoying that you need to click
back to the status page.

[1] https://github.com/thomaslindner/fesimdaq
ELOG V3.1.4-2e1708b5